Influence of Bicyclol on Survival Condition of Tumor-bearing Mice

Abstract: ObjectiveTo investigate the effect of bicyclol and combinative effect of bicyclol with anti-tumor drugs on survival condition of tumor-bearing mice. MethodsKunming mice transplanted with S180 sarcoma were administrated with 200 mg·kg-1 bicyclol for 7 days, and simultaneously injected with 8 mg·kg-1 adriamycin or 70 mg·kg-1 cyclophosphamide at the first day and sixth day. After treatment, six mice of each group were sacrificed and the inhibitory rate of tumor growth was calculated. Animal death in the remaining animals was recorded. C57BL/6 mice were administrated with 150 mg·kg-1 bicyclol for 14 days after 9 days transplanted with Lewis lung carcinoma. C57BL/6 mice were treated with bicyclol(50 mg·kg-1,100 mg·kg-1) for 18 days after 5 days transplanted with B16-F10 melanoma carcinoma. In these two models, the body weight and survival condition of mice were observed. ResultsIn S180 sarcoma and B16-F10 melanoma tumor-bearing mice models, bicyclol significantly prolonged the median survival time and decreased the mortality rate of tumor-bearing mice.
